Simple Cedar Bowl

My cousin brought me over a load of cedar and when I asked him what he would like in return, he said "just a simple bowl". So, that's what he got. The grain was too nice to mess around with anyway. A little texturing on the rim. Finished with Tung Oil and Beall buffed. 12" dia. X 5" tall. Thanks for looking and all comments welcome, Don L.
